Web21 de nov. de 2024 · Small rise in heart attack protein linked to increased risk of early death in all age groups 21st Nov 2024 A new analysis of patients’ heart data at Imperial College Healthcare NHS Trust has shown that even a slight increase in a protein linked to heart attacks, called troponin, is linked to an increased risk of early death at all ages.
